What is a Pro Associate?

A Pro Associate is typically an entry- or mid-level professional who provides support and expertise within a specific department or field, such as sales, customer service, or technical support. The role often involves assisting senior staff, handling client interactions, and contributing to the team's projects and goals. Pro Associates may also be responsible for administrative tasks, data analysis, or process improvement initiatives, depending on the industry. The position can serve as a stepping stone to more advanced roles within an organization.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Pro Associate, and why are they important?

To excel as a Pro Associate, you need strong customer service skills, product knowledge, and preferably experience in retail or sales environments. Familiarity with point-of-sale (POS) systems, inventory management software, and sometimes certifications in sales or customer relations are valuable. Standout candidates demonstrate excellent communication, problem-solving abilities, and a proactive approach to assisting clients. These skills ensure efficient service delivery, build customer loyalty, and support overall business growth.

People & Culture (Human Resources) Generalist

Here’s what the job would look like:

As the People and Culture (P&C) Manager, you will coordinate, administer and report on various human resource programs, system and procedures to aid in the attraction, retention and motivation of employees in accordance with policies, procedures and government laws and regulations while promoting a safe, fair, positive work environment. You are responsible for all recruiting, hiring and daily administration of various salary, benefit, government and employee relations programs. Part of your job is to recommend and implement procedural/process changes.


Here are your job responsibilities:

  • Manage all recruiting, screening, interviewing, performing reference checks and coordinating department interviews for management and hourly candidates to ensure quality hires and compliance with federal, state and local laws and regulations.
  • Manage the employment process from recruitment to hiring, and related advertising and documentation.
  • Manage and implement the various in-house training programs to ensure consistent administration & reduce turnover, provide open communication and promote a positive and pro-associate work environment.
  • Advocate the Open Door Policy by assisting in the counseling and/or discipline of associates as needed, through clear, calm and direct oral written communication, in accordance with the guidelines established by OLS Hotels & Resorts, dba Springboard Hospitality.
  • To manage, direct and monitor the associate assets of the company, perpetuating an environment that is profitable, while meeting all health, safety and sanitation needs.
  • Manage Paycom. Review Payroll & input/update new hires, make daily changes to ensure accurate, up to date information is available for payroll and management.
  • Administer all associate benefit programs, act as the intermediary with insurance and 401K plan administrators, reconcile all monthly billing to in house roster, ensures monthly premiums are paid in a timely manner, coordinates and control all benefit audits including group health insurance, COBRA, vacation, sick, leave of absences, jury duty pay and others such as Health Fairs, Los Angeles Region Metro Bus Pass Program, Associate Discounted Rooms Program, discount coupons, etc.
  • Coordinate and manage Workers Compensation by maintaining verbal and written communication with injured associate(s), claims administration office, doctors, and departmental supervisors regarding the status of injured associate(s). Coordinates the legal aspects of Workers’ Compensation cases. Maintains accurate records of all verbal and written correspondence. Accurately prepares and maintains all Workers Compensation statistics including first reports, individual files, modified duty, and follow-up medical reports.
  • Update and disseminate information regarding Workers’ Compensation as it relates to trends, regulations and the laws, ensuring full compliance. Ensures accident reports are properly investigated and reviews accident loss run reports to determine accident trends, progress and cost containment measures.
  • Manage Leave of Absence Program and traces all Leaves of Absence to ensure compliance with Leave of absence Policy in conjunction with Federal/State protected Leave programs such as FMLA, Pregnancy, CFRA, Kin Care, Military, etc. Trace Leaves of Absence to include monitoring return dates of associates, verifying doctor’s notes, collecting insurance payments as necessary and responding to State Disability program.
  • Manage Unemployment Claims and coordinates compliance between EDD/Hotel and Unemployment representative. Ensure Managers attend Unemployment Hearings.
  • Develop advertising for Benefits & Associate Relation Events; and keep associate bulletin boards current, including, but not limited to: communicate legal requirement, associate feedback, post memos, pictures of associate events, loss prevention materials.
  • Perform other duties and responsibilities as required.
  • Notify all managers monthly of reviews due & track completed reviews to ensure they are given in a timely manner.
  • Bring all sensitive associate-related information to the attention of the General Manager in all instances to limit liability.
  • Conduct exit interviews, track trends and complete accurate turnover reports as needed.
  • Position hotel as the "preferred employer" in the area by maintaining strong community relations with referral agencies to maintain strong applicant flow.
  • Process P&C forms and respond to written and oral inquiries regarding verification of employment, wages, unemployment compensation & worker's compensation claims, in a manner which is consistent and ensures that liability is minimized.
